#include "ft_printf.h"
int ft_formatter(const char format, va_list args)
{
int l;
l = 0;
if (format == 'c')
l = ft_putchar(va_arg(args, int));
else if (format == 's')
l = ft_putstr(va_arg(args, char *));
else if (format == 'd' || format == 'i')
l = ft_putnbr(va_arg(args, int));
else if (format == 'u')
l = ft_putnbr(va_arg(args, unsigned int));
else if (format == 'x')
l = ft_puthex(va_arg(args, unsigned int), 0, "0123456789abcdef");
else if (format == 'X')
l = ft_puthex(va_arg(args, unsigned int), 0, "0123456789ABCDEF");
else if (format == 'p')
l = ft_puthex(va_arg(args, unsigned long), 1, "0123456789abcdef");
else if (format == '%')
l = ft_putchar('%');
if (l == -1)
return (-1);
return (l);
}
int ft_printf(const char *str, ...)
{
va_list args;
int i;
int len;
int total_len;
i = 0;
len = 0;
total_len = 0;
va_start(args, str);
while (str[i])
{
if (str[i] == '%')
len = ft_formatter(str[++i], args);
else
len = write(1, &str[i], 1);
if (len == -1)
return (-1);
total_len += len;
i++;
}
va_end(args);
return (total_len);
}
